Abstract
The invention relates to the technical field of motor assembly, in particular to an oil seal clamp and a framework oil seal installation method. An oil seal clamp comprises a first clamp body and a second clamp body, wherein the first clamp body and the second clamp body are semi-annular; one end of the first clamp body is rotatably connected to one end of the second clamp body around a rotating axis, and the rotating axis is parallel to the axes of the first clamp body and the second clamp body; the other end of the first clamp body is detachably connected with the other end of the second clamp body, so that an annular inner circumferential surface for clamping a framework oil seal is formed after the other end of the first clamp body is connected with the other end of the second clamp body. The oil seal clamp can improve the assembly efficiency and the assembly quality of the framework oil seal so as to avoid the water leakage.

Referring to fig. 1-3, fig. 1 and 2 show the structure of an oil seal clamp 200 in an embodiment of the present invention, and fig. 3 shows a schematic clamping diagram of the oil seal clamp 200 and a framework oil seal 300 in an embodiment of the present invention; the embodiment provides an oil seal clamp 200, and the oil seal clamp 200 includes a first clamp 210 and a second clamp 220, and the first clamp 210 and the second clamp 220 are both semi-annular.
One end of the first clamp body 210 is rotatably connected to one end of the second clamp body 220 around a rotation axis, and the rotation axis is parallel to the axes of the first clamp body 210 and the second clamp body 220; the other end of the first clip body 210 is detachably connected with the other end of the second clip body 220 to form an annular inner circumferential surface that clamps the framework oil seal 300 after the other end of the first clip body 210 is connected with the other end of the second clip body 220.
It should be noted that, firstly, when the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220 are disposed, since the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220 are both semi-annular, the inner circumferential surfaces of the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220 are both arc-shaped, and two ends of the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220, which are connected to each other, are annular two ends; in addition, when the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220 are disposed, the annular dimension parameters may be consistent, that is, the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220 may form an annular shape after being connected.
The working principle of the oil seal clamp 200 is as follows:
the oil seal clamp 200 includes a first clamp 210 and a second clamp 220, and the first clamp 210 and the second clamp 220 are semi-annular. One end of the first clamp body 210 is rotatably connected to one end of the second clamp body 220 around a rotation axis, and the rotation axis is parallel to the axes of the first clamp body 210 and the second clamp body 220; the other end of the first clip body 210 is detachably connected with the other end of the second clip body 220.
Therefore, the oil seal clamp 200 can enable one ends of the first clamp body 210 and the second clamp body 220 which are detachably connected to be matched with or separated from each other under the action of external force, so that the oil seal clamp 200 is in an unfolded state or in a closed state; when the other end of the first clamp 210 is connected with the other end of the second clamp 220, and is in a closed state, since the first clamp 210 and the second clamp 220 are both semi-annular, the inner peripheral surfaces of the first clamp 210 and the second clamp 220 are connected, so that the annular inner peripheral surface of the framework oil seal 300 can be formed in a sealed manner, and the framework oil seal 300 can be clamped by the oil seal clamp 200, so that the framework oil seal 300 can be mounted conveniently, and the assembly efficiency and the assembly quality of the framework oil seal 300 can be improved.
Further, referring to fig. 1 to 3, in the present embodiment, since the inner peripheral surfaces of the first clip 210 and the second clip 220 are both in contact with the framework oil seal 300, when the first clip 210 and the second clip 220 are disposed, the inner peripheral surfaces of the first clip 210 and the second clip 220 have a shape corresponding to the outer peripheral surface of the framework oil seal 300, so that the fitting degree between the oil seal clamp 200 and the framework oil seal 300 is improved by such a disposition, thereby improving the clamping stability, and the framework oil seal 300 can be prevented from being damaged or deformed during the process of clamping the framework oil seal 300 by such a disposition.
In the present embodiment, when the oil seal holder 200 holds the framework oil seal 300, it holds the lip portion 310 of the framework oil seal 300, so that when the inner circumferential surfaces of the first clip 210 and the second clip 220 are provided, the inner circumferential surfaces of the first clip 210 and the second clip 220 are provided with the grooves corresponding to the lip portion 310 of the framework oil seal 300.
Further, in this embodiment, the purpose of clamping the framework oil seal 300 by the oil seal fixture 200 is to improve the assembly quality and the assembly efficiency of the framework oil seal 300, and based on this, when the oil seal fixture 200 is disposed, the end surfaces of the two ends of the first clamp 210 and the second clamp 220 can be both set to be a plane along the axial direction of the first clamp 210, and the two end surfaces of the first clamp 210 are in the same plane with the two end surfaces of the second clamp 220 respectively. From this for the terminal surface at oil blanket anchor clamps 200's both ends is the plane, through such mode of setting, can be at the in-process of installation skeleton oil blanket 300, through the butt of oil blanket anchor clamps 200 with in-wheel motor housing to play the effect of location, with efficiency and the quality of improvement installation.
The first clamp 210 and the second clamp 220 are detachably connected, so that the oil seal clamp 200 can be conveniently unfolded and closed, the difficulty of clamping the framework oil seal 300 is reduced, and the difficulty of installing the framework oil seal 300 is reduced. Therefore, in order to facilitate the oil seal clamp 200 to be opened and closed, there are various detachable connection manners of the first clamp body 210 and the second clamp body 220, and in this embodiment, a magnetic member 230 is disposed at the detachable connection portion of the first clamp body 210 and the second clamp body 220, so that the first clamp body 210 is magnetically attracted to the second clamp body 220. Namely, the first clamp body 210 and the second clamp body 220 can be attracted together by magnetic attraction, and the manner is also convenient for the oil seal clamp 200 to be unfolded. In other embodiments of the present invention, clamping portions may be disposed at detachable connection positions of the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220, so that the first clip body 210 and the second clip body 220 are clamped.
Referring to fig. 1 to 5, fig. 4 and 5 show steps of assembling a framework oil seal in an embodiment of the present invention, based on the oil seal fixture 200, an embodiment of the present invention further provides a framework oil seal installation method, where the framework oil seal installation method uses the oil seal fixture 200, and includes the following steps:
clamping a framework oil seal 300 by using an oil seal clamp 200;
pressing the framework oil seal 300 positioned outside the oil seal clamp 200 into the mounting hole 410 of the hub motor end cover 400;
the oil seal clamp 200 is unfolded, and the framework oil seal 300 positioned outside the mounting hole 410 is pressed into the mounting hole 410.
Further, in the present embodiment, the step of clamping the skeleton oil seal 300 using the oil seal clamp 200 includes:
expanding the oil seal jig 200 so that the lip portion 310 of the skeleton oil seal 300 is positioned inside the first and second clip bodies 210 and 220;
the oil seal jig 200 is closed so that the lip portion 310 of the skeleton oil seal 300 abuts the inner side surfaces of the first and second clip bodies 210 and 220.
In this embodiment, when the framework oil seal 300 located outside the oil seal fixture 200 is pressed into the mounting hole 410 of the end cover 400 of the hub motor, external force acts on the oil seal fixture 200, namely, external force is applied to the oil seal fixture 200 to press the framework oil seal 300 into the mounting hole 410, so that the stress of the framework oil seal 300 is uniform, and the framework oil seal 300 is prevented from deforming due to the fact that external force is applied to the framework oil seal 300, and water leakage is caused.
Further, the step of pressing the framework oil seal 300 outside the oil seal fixture 200 into the mounting hole 410 of the hub motor end cover 400 includes:
after the framework oil seal 300 located outside the oil seal fixture 200 abuts against the end of the mounting hole 410, an external force is applied to the oil seal fixture 200, so that the oil seal fixture 200 moves toward the mounting hole 410 until the side of the oil seal fixture 200 facing the mounting hole 410 abuts against the mounting hole 410.
